Tree Removal & Heritage Trees

In West Allis, no one may cut, prune, remove, or treat a tree or shrub growing in the city terrace or boulevard strip without written permission from the Director of Public Works, per § 11.135.

West Allis Terrace Tree Removal Permit

Significant Restrictions

West Allis Revised Municipal Code § 11.135

No person shall plant, cut, prune, or remove any tree or shrub in a City terrace or boulevard; cut, disturb or interfere in any way with the roots of any tree or shrub in a City terrace or boulevard; or spray any tree or shrub in a City terrace or boulevard with any chemical herbicide or insecticide, without first receiving permission from the Director of Public Works. Weed Ordinances

West Allis caps grass in lawn areas at 6 inches and bans noxious weeds under the Property Maintenance Code, Revised Municipal Code § 13.28(10)(b); the city can mow and bill violators.

West Allis Lawn Grass & Weed Height Limit

Some Restrictions

West Allis Revised Municipal Code § 13.28(10)(b)

Grass shall not exceed six (6) inches in height. Noxious weeds are not permitted and shall be destroyed, as provided in § 66.0407 of the Wisconsin Statutes. Lawn areas shall be graded properly to allow for maintenance.
